Zmienny

Rejestr ansible o zmiennej nazwie

Rejestr ansible o zmiennej nazwie
  1. Jak zarejestrować zmienną w Ansible?
  2. Jak używać vars w Ansible?
  3. Jakie są prawidłowe nazwy zmiennych ansible?
  4. Jak przekazać zmienną wartość w Ansible Playbook?
  5. Jak deklarujesz zmienną rejestru?
  6. Gdzie jest zmienna do rejestracji?
  7. Jak korzystać z wyjścia rejestru w Ansible?
  8. Co to jest słowo kluczowe rejestru w Ansible?
  9. Jak przypisać wartość zmienną w Ansible?
  10. Jak napisać prawidłową nazwę zmiennej?
  11. Jaki jest prawidłowy przykład nazwy zmiennej?
  12. Co jest dozwolone w nazwie zmiennej?
  13. Jak zarejestrować wyjście ansible?
  14. Co oznacza rejestr w Ansible?
  15. Który operator może być używany do zmiennej rejestracji?
  16. Jaka jest różnica między powiadomieniem a rejestrem w Ansible?
  17. Co to jest RC w wyjściowym wyjściu?
  18. Jak uzyskać dostęp do zmiennych w Ansible?

Jak zarejestrować zmienną w Ansible?

Utwórz nowy podręcznik i dodaj następującą definicję gry. Zmodyfikuj parametry definicji Play zgodnie z wymaganiami. Mam następujące zadanie, które użyje modułu powłoki do uruchomienia polecenia „What VirtualeNV”. Wyjście tego zadania jest przechwytywane w zmiennej rejestru o nazwie „Virtualenv_output”.

Jak używać vars w Ansible?

Zdefiniuj zmienne Ansible w czasie wykonywania poradników

Zmienne można również zdefiniować podczas wykonywania podręcznika, przekazując zmienne w wierszu poleceń za pomocą argumentu -extra -vars lub -e. Zmienna jest zamknięta w jednokwuotowanym sznurku wewnątrz pary pojedynczych kręconych aparatów ortodontycznych.

Jakie są prawidłowe nazwy zmiennych ansible?

Tworzenie prawidłowych nazw zmiennych

Zmienna nazwa może zawierać tylko litery, cyfry i podkreślenia. Słowa kluczowe w Python lub słowa kluczowe podręcznika nie są prawidłowymi nazwami zmiennych. Nazwa zmiennej nie może zaczynać się od liczby. Zmienne nazwy mogą zacząć od podkreślenia.

Jak przekazać zmienną wartość w Ansible Playbook?

Aby przekazać wartość do węzłów, użyj opcji -extra -vars lub -e podczas uruchamiania podręcznika Ansible, jak pokazano poniżej. Zapewnia to uniknięcie przypadkowego uruchomienia podręcznika przeciwko hardkodowanym gospodarzom.

Jak deklarujesz zmienną rejestru?

Zmienne rejestru, poinformuj kompilatora do przechowywania zmiennej w rejestrze procesora zamiast pamięci. Często używane zmienne są przechowywane w rejestrach i mają one szybszą dostępność. Nigdy nie możemy uzyskać adresów tych zmiennych. Słowo kluczowe „rejestru” służy do deklarowania zmiennych rejestru.

Gdzie jest zmienna do rejestracji?

Zmienne rejestru są przechowywane w rejestrach. Zmienna statyczna jest przechowywana w pamięci segmentu danych. W zmiennych rejestrów sam procesor przechowuje dane i dostęp.

Jak korzystać z wyjścia rejestru w Ansible?

Ansible Register to sposób na przechwycenie danych wyjściowych z wykonania zadania i przechowywanie w zmiennej. Jest to ważna funkcja, ponieważ to wyjście jest różne dla każdego zdalnego hosta, a podstawa, na podstawie których możemy użyć pętli warunków, aby wykonać inne zadania. Ponadto każda wartość rejestru jest ważna w całym wykonaniu podręcznika.

Co to jest słowo kluczowe rejestru w Ansible?

Rejestr - Wyjście akcji jest zarejestrowane za pomocą słowa kluczowego i wyjścia rejestru, to nazwa zmiennej, która utrzymuje wyjście akcji. Zawsze - znowu słowo kluczowe ansible, stwierdza, że ​​poniżej zawsze będzie wykonywane. MSG - wyświetla wiadomość.

Jak przypisać wartość zmienną w Ansible?

Ansible pozwala również na ustawienie zmiennych bezpośrednio w zadaniu za pomocą modułu set_fact. Zmienne zdefiniowane za pomocą set_fact stają się powiązane z hostem, z którym działa zadanie, które udostępnia je w kolejnych zadaniach przez cały czas trwania gry.

Jak napisać prawidłową nazwę zmiennej?

Prawidłowa nazwa zmiennej zaczyna się od litery, a następnie liter, cyfr lub podkreśla.

Jaki jest prawidłowy przykład nazwy zmiennej?

Prawidłowa nazwa zmiennej zaczyna się od litera i zawiera nie więcej niż znaki MEMELEGHMAX. Prawidłowe nazwy zmiennych mogą obejmować litery, cyfry i podkreślenia. Słowa kluczowe MATLAB nie są prawidłowymi nazwami zmiennych.

Co jest dozwolone w nazwie zmiennej?

Okres, podkreślenie i postacie $, #i @ mogą być używane w nazwach zmiennych. Na przykład a. _ $@#1 to prawidłowa nazwa zmiennej.

Jak zarejestrować wyjście ansible?

Aby uchwycić dane wyjściowe, musisz określić własną zmienną, na którą wyjście zostanie zapisane. Aby to osiągnąć, używamy parametru „Rejestr” do rejestrowania danych wyjściowych do zmiennej. Następnie użyj modułu „debugowania”, aby wyświetlić zawartość zmiennej do standardu.

Co oznacza rejestr w Ansible?

Ansible Register to sposób na przechwycenie danych wyjściowych z wykonania zadania i przechowywanie w zmiennej. Jest to ważna funkcja, ponieważ to wyjście jest różne dla każdego zdalnego hosta, a podstawa, na podstawie których możemy użyć pętli warunków, aby wykonać inne zadania. Ponadto każda wartość rejestru jest ważna w całym wykonaniu podręcznika.

Który operator może być używany do zmiennej rejestracji?

W języku programowania C nie możemy korzystać z operatora adresu (&) ze zmiennymi zadeklarowanymi za pomocą specyfikatora klasy rejestru. Ale jeśli stworzymy program C ++ i wykonamy to samo zadanie (i.e Użyj & ze zmienną pamięci rejestru) nie daje nam żadnego błędu.

Jaka jest różnica między powiadomieniem a rejestrem w Ansible?

Zarejestrowane zmienne są podobne do faktów: skutecznie zarejestrowane zmienne są jak fakty. To bardzo różni się od powiadomienia, które wyzwala przewodniki. Nie zapisuje ani nie przechowuje zmiennych ani faktów.

Co to jest RC w wyjściowym wyjściu?

RC. Niektóre moduły wykonują narzędzia wiersza poleceń lub są ukierunkowane na bezpośrednio wykonywanie poleceń (surowe, powłoki, polecenie itd.), To pole zawiera „kod powrotu” tych narzędzi.

Jak uzyskać dostęp do zmiennych w Ansible?

Aby zdefiniować zmienną w podręczniku, po prostu użyj słów kluczowych Vars przed napisaniem zmiennych z wgłębieniem. Aby uzyskać dostęp do wartości zmiennej, umieść ją między podwójnymi klamrami kręconymi zamkniętymi ze znakami cytatowymi. W powyższym podręczniku zmienna pozdrowienia jest zastąpiona wartością Hello World!

Jak mogę używać zmiennych środowiskowych nie-TF w teraform?
Jak przechowywać zmienne środowiskowe w terraform?Jaka jest różnica między zmienną terraform a zmienną środowiskową?Jak stworzyć zmienną terraformę w...
Spust gałęzi dziki nie działa dla Azure Devops
Jak wywołać Jenkinsa z Azure Devops?Jak wywołać rurociąg w Azure Devops?Jak automatycznie wyzwolić rurociąg zwolnienia w Azure DevOps?Czy możemy mieć...
Gitlab „grupy” tylko dla uprawnień?
Jaka jest różnica między grupą a podgrupą w Gitlab?Jak wyłączyć tworzenie grup w Gitlab?Jak przyznać dostęp do prywatnego projektu w Gitlab?Co to są ...